It is possible to balance a vacation with not overextending an injury. My DH was pretty much a semi-invalid for a number of years (thankfully he's making great progress now) with fibro. We found cruises were great - he could just rest on the days he wasn't up to going out. If your DH is one to happily occupy himself alone, it might be a great thing. The trick is that you both have to be firm with everyone else that this is fine, he just needs to take care of himself, and he'll join in when he can. The other thing is you really need to get rides in airports - the little electric carts are wonderful, especially with a close connection. And if you have access to a handicapped parking permit, bring it along. You can usually get a temporary one pretty quickly. Best of luck with this!
